#31db08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31db08 is composed of 19.2% red, 85.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 108.3 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 44.5%. #31db08 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ff10 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#31db08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31db08 has RGB values of R:49, G:219,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3267336.

Shades and Tints of #31db08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b00 is the darkest color, while #f8fff7 is the lightest one.
